Python vs Excel for Data Analysis: Which Should You Learn First?

0
222
Python, Excel, data analysis, learn Python, learn Excel, data analysis tools, Python vs Excel, data science skills ## Introduction In today's data-driven landscape, the ability to analyze data effectively is more crucial than ever. Professionals across various industries are continually seeking tools that can help them derive insights from data. Among the most popular options for data analysis are Python and Excel. But which one should you learn first? This article explores the differences between Python and Excel for data analysis, when to use each tool, and how to choose based on your professional profile. ## Understanding the Basics: Excel Excel is an established spreadsheet application known for its user-friendly interface and efficiency in handling data tasks. It allows users to perform calculations, create charts, and manipulate data through its intuitive grid format. Here's a breakdown of why Excel remains a go-to tool for data analysis: ### Familiarity and Accessibility One of Excel's strongest advantages is its accessibility. With a relatively low learning curve, it’s often the first tool that professionals encounter. Its features are widely understood, making it a staple in many workplaces. For those just starting in data analysis, Excel provides a solid foundation in basic data manipulation and visualization. ### Key Features of Excel - **Built-in Functions:** Excel offers a plethora of built-in functions that cater to various data analysis needs, such as statistical functions, financial calculations, and logical operations. - **Pivot Tables:** This powerful feature allows users to summarize and analyze large data sets quickly, making it easier to identify trends and patterns. - **Data Visualization:** With its charting tools, Excel enables users to create visually appealing graphs and dashboards to present their findings effectively. ## Delving Deeper: Python While Excel excels in many areas, Python brings a different set of capabilities to the table. As a versatile programming language, Python has become a favorite among data scientists and analysts alike. Here’s why you might consider learning Python for data analysis: ### Flexibility and Power Python’s flexibility allows it to handle complex data tasks that may be cumbersome in Excel. From automating repetitive tasks to performing intricate statistical analyses, Python is a powerful tool for those looking to dive deeper into data. ### Key Features of Python - **Libraries and Frameworks:** With a robust ecosystem of libraries such as Pandas, NumPy, and Matplotlib, Python provides extensive functionalities for data manipulation, analysis, and visualization. - **Scalability:** Python can handle large datasets far more efficiently than Excel, making it suitable for big data applications. - **Automation:** Python scripts can automate repetitive tasks, saving time and reducing the risk of human error. ## When to Use Excel vs. Python Choosing between Excel and Python often depends on specific tasks and your professional context. Here are some scenarios to help you decide when to use each tool: ### Use Excel When: 1. **You Need Quick Insights:** If you require immediate analysis of small to medium-sized datasets, Excel's straightforward interface allows for rapid insight generation. 2. **You’re Collaborating with Non-Technical Teams:** Excel is widely understood, making it easier to share findings with colleagues who may not have a technical background. 3. **You’re Working with Financial Data:** Excel's financial functions and templates make it ideal for budgeting, forecasting, and other financial analyses. ### Use Python When: 1. **You’re Dealing with Large Datasets:** For extensive datasets, Python outperforms Excel in terms of speed and capability. 2. **You Need Advanced Statistical Analysis:** Python’s libraries provide advanced statistical functions and machine learning capabilities that Excel simply cannot match. 3. **You Want to Automate Processes:** If your analysis involves repetitive tasks, Python can automate these processes, saving you time and effort. ## Which Should You Learn First? Determining whether to learn Python or Excel first largely depends on your career goals and existing skill set. Here are some factors to consider: ### For Beginners If you’re just starting in data analysis and have little to no programming experience, beginning with Excel might be the best approach. It will provide foundational skills and a basic understanding of data analysis concepts. Once you’re comfortable with Excel, transitioning to Python will be much easier. ### For Aspiring Data Scientists If you aim to pursue a career in data science or analytics, learning Python first is advisable. Python is a core skill in the industry and will equip you with the tools necessary for more advanced data tasks. Familiarity with Excel can complement your Python skills, especially for tasks involving quick analyses or presentations. ### For Professionals Looking to Upskill If you already have experience with Excel and want to enhance your data analysis capabilities, diving into Python can open new doors. Learning Python will not only broaden your skill set but also improve your efficiency in handling complex data challenges. ## Conclusion In the debate of Python vs. Excel for data analysis, both tools have their distinct advantages and ideal use cases. Excel is perfect for quick analyses and basic data tasks, while Python is better suited for complex analyses and automation. Your choice of which tool to learn first should align with your professional goals, existing skills, and the specific demands of your industry. Ultimately, mastering both tools will equip you with a comprehensive skill set that can significantly enhance your data analysis capabilities and career prospects. Source: https://datademia.es/blog/python-vs-excel-para-analisis-de-datos
Search
Categories
Read More
Games
Netflix Middle East Launch: Adel Karam Comedy Special
Netflix ventures into the Middle East with a groundbreaking original, spotlighting Lebanese...
By Xtameem Xtameem 2026-02-10 03:06:15 0 152
Games
Walmart Trading Card Policy: 5-Item Limit Explained
Walmart has recently implemented a new policy aimed at curbing scalping activities in its stores...
By Xtameem Xtameem 2025-11-27 14:50:47 0 601
Games
Netflix's 'Sextuplets': Cast & Release Details
Marlon Wayans and Bresha Webb lead the cast of the upcoming Netflix film "Sextuplets," a project...
By Xtameem Xtameem 2026-03-07 01:59:17 0 134
Games
Harry Potter Audiobooks: New Voices Join Ensemble
Pottermore Publishing and Audible expand their magical ensemble with fresh voices for the Harry...
By Xtameem Xtameem 2025-10-23 05:09:39 0 1K
Art
Demon Tides: The Speed and Splendor of an Old PlayStation Platforming Classic
Demon Tides, platforming games, open world, nostalgic gaming, PlayStation classics, game...
By Bella Hazel 2026-02-27 13:20:32 0 742
FrendVibe https://frendvibe.com